What is the objective of a chess game?

The primary objective of a chess game is to checkmate the opponents king. Checkmate occurs when the king is in check and cannot escape capture by moving to a square not under attack, blocking the check with another piece, or capturing the checking piece.

How long does a typical chess game last?

The duration of a chess game can vary greatly. In casual play, games might last from 15 minutes to a few hours. In competitive play, such as tournaments, games can extend to several hours or even days, especially in slow chess or correspondence chess.

How can I improve my chess skills?

Improving your chess skills involves a combination of study, practice, and analysis. Here are some tips:

1. Study opening principles to understand how to develop your pieces effectively.

2. Learn about pawn structure and how to avoid weaknesses.

3. Practice endgames to improve your tactical skills.

4. Analyze your games to identify mistakes and learn from them.

5. Play regularly to keep your skills sharp and adapt to different styles of play.

Is chess a good game for children to learn?

Absolutely, chess is an excellent game for children. It teaches critical thinking, problemsolving skills, and strategic planning. It also helps improve concentration, memory, and patience.
